No. Not happy.

They say "blaze your own trail"...but the tools with which to blaze are incredibly limited in scope.
Can't really be a smuggler.
Can't raid moon bases for data to turn a profit.
Can't really scavenge for a profit with a 2 item limit on SCV cargo plus the worth of what you're scavenging.
Can't really be a pirate anymore with the cargo restrictions.

Exploring would be interesting if every single moon didn't look exactly the same, down to the same composition of pebbles, rocks, and boulders. No cave systems, or any significant geological features.

Mission system is completely randomized with RNG re: time vs reward.

PVE combat is always the same...not very challenging.
CQC is dead. Easier to just play EVE: Valkyrie.

People say this game will get better.....sooo when is that? I've been waiting a couple years already. They have my money. Frankly my patience ran out, which is why I don't play ED anymore.
